2009 Top 21 Social Media Superstars: John Walter, Executive Editor, Successful Farming

Being a risk-taker has paid off handsome dividends for Walter. Having helped build Agricultural Online, the digital extension for Successful Farming (and Meredith’s first-ever Web site) 14 years ago, Walter applied his masterly skills as a cutting-edge innovator and pioneer in the digital space to his most recent social media initiative: the launch and development of Farmers for the Future, a social network for young and beginning farmers. The venture has been so successful that Walter is frequently called upon in the agricultural community to speak on social media or provide guidance on how to develop social media programs. Walter is unusally modest, and credits his success to finding and collaborating with talented individuals. But he also cites another more elusive factor: “The muses have been willing to whisper a word or two to me over the years,” he quips.
